#53c184 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53c184 is composed of 32.5% red, 75.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.7 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 54.1%. #53c184 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#008309.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#53c184 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53c184 has RGB values of R:83, G:193,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5489028.

Shades and Tints of #53c184
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53c184
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b8a is the less saturated color, while #1df77e is the most saturated one.
